Owens Corning acquires Asahi's composites business

16-May-06
Owens Corning has acquired the composites business of Japan's Asahi Fiber Glass Company. Owens Corning is a world leader in building materials systems and composite solutions. This acquisition strengthens an increased commitment to the Japanese market and will support Owens' global growth and expand the company's product solutions portfolio. The products manufactured at the Japanese facility will support global growth by delivering a broader range of composite solutions for the consumer and electrical, building and construction, and infrastructure markets. The acquisition includes: o Reinforcements for high-performance thermoplastics such as Liquid Crystaline Polymer (LCP), Polyphenylene Sulfide (PPS) and Polyphenylene Oxide (PPO) polymer products. These composite products are used in applications where high performance is required. o Long-fiber thermoplastic compounds for the Asia Pacific market used in light-weight and semi-structural applications. o Sheet Molding Compounds for the Japanese market, including high-heat industrial and Class-A applications for automotive and consumer markets. o Rubber-coated glass-fiber solutions used in engine timing belts for the automotive industry.
